Fortunately, organizations can make their workplaces and teams more diverse and inclusive. WebMar 1, 2024 · Inclusive Teams Are More Attractive to Candidates. According to a Glassdoor survey, 76% of job seekers believe that the inclusion and diversity of a team are imperative factors when it comes to evaluating different companies. Professionals prefer to work with companies that accept people from all races, cultures, genders, and religions. citizens bank cranston hours
